Fusing reason of high-voltage fuse when the circuit passes through overload current and short-circuit current

The main reason why high-voltage fuses fuse when the circuit passes the overload current and short-circuit current is that the selected fuse specifications are incorrect. For the high current protection zone, the selected high-voltage fuse shall have the following performances:

1. Large capacity, generally between tens and hundreds of A;

2. Capable of withstanding instantaneous high current and high pulse;

3. Safe and reliable;

4. The operating ambient temperature is relatively high;

5. Good mechanical properties.

Precautions for use of high-voltage fuse:

1. The protection characteristics of high-voltage fuse shall adapt to the overload characteristics of the protected object. Considering the possible short-circuit current, fuse with corresponding breaking capacity shall be selected;

2. The rated voltage of high-voltage fuse shall adapt to the line voltage level, and the rated current of fuse shall be greater than or equal to the rated current of melt;

3. The rated current of fuse melts at all levels in the line shall be matched accordingly, and the rated current of the previous level must be greater than that of the next level;

4. The melt of high-voltage fuse shall be matched according to the requirements. It is not allowed to increase the melt at will or replace the melt with other conductors.
